Analysis
In 2000, Poland's population on 1 january by age and sex decreased by 1.0% compared to 1999, reaching 38,263,303.
Poland accounts for 8.9% of the EU-27 total of 428,473,834.
Poland ranks 5th out of 27 EU member states with reported data — in the top half of the distribution.
Over the past five years, the indicator has fallen by 0.8% (from 38,580,597 in 1995).
Source: Eurostat dataset demo_pjan, accessed via the eupublicdata pipeline.
